Hi, I want Obfsproxy to listen on both IPv4 and IPv6 interfaces by using the following lines in torrc:
ServerTransportPlugin obfs2,obfs3 exec /usr/bin/obfsproxy managed ServerTransportListenAddr obfs2 0.0.0.0:42862 ServerTransportListenAddr obfs3 0.0.0.0:49991 ServerTransportListenAddr obfs2 [2001:xxxx::63:7572:6c79]:42862 ServerTransportListenAddr obfs3 [2001:xxxx::63:7572:6c79]:49991 I noticed, only the first line gets interpreted for each Obfsproxy protocol. I can force to listen only on IPv6 by commenting out the lines for IPv4, but I'd prefer to have a dual-stack bridge. I don't remember having this behaviour the first time I installed an Obfsproxy bridge. If I remember correctly, it worked previously, but meanwhile it is broken.
